Some Examples: (There are many more, but I won't list them all here--this is
to give you an idea)

- The City of Gahanna in Ohio discovered a discrepancy that gave 4,000 votes
to George Bush. After media scrutiny, city officials have admitted to an
electronic "glitch" that caused the problem.

- In Broward County, FL, errors in software code caused a referendum on
gambling to be completely overturned. The error caused totals to count
backwards after reaching a ceiling of 32,500 votes. The problem existed in the
2002 election as well however the issue was never resolved by the manufacturer
of the electronic voting machine.

- In North Carolina, a Craven County district logged 11,283 more votes than
voters and actually overturned the results of a regional race.

KharmaDog
That's where I disagree rages. I don't think Bush believed that there were any WMD's there. For years they had credible sources say that Sadam had dismantled his chemical/biological weapons and his nuclear program. He had very restricted airspace, and not enough money and resources to re-establish a very effective conventional force.

I've have brought it up before, but Colin Powell said it (feb 24, 2001) and Rice backed him up (July 2001) that all intelligence reports show that Sadam Hussien poses absolutely no threat to the United states or even to the stability of the region.

Then all of a sudden (conveniently after 911) all these reports about Iraq's weapons programs surface. Not one report came from a credible source, and not one report has yet proven true. The excuse that we had to go in because Sadam would not let in UN inspectors is a crock o' shit. The american government knew that Sadam wouldn't let in UN inspectors because Sadam had found out that the US had previously sent in CIA agents with other inspection teams. It was for that reason and personal pride (to save face and look strong for his subjects) that Sadam refused the inspections. It was a game that both sides had been playing, and Bush upped the anti pretty damn quick.

Bush had plenty of intelligence and proof that Sadam was no threat, and he knew that there was no terrorist link. That is why many of the world's nations and people (and from what I see many american citizens) are angry.
